diff options
-rw-r--r-- | ChangeLog | 6 | ||||
-rw-r--r-- | auth-krb4.c | 3 |
2 files changed, 7 insertions, 2 deletions
@@ -37,6 +37,10 @@ | |||
37 | [auth.h auth1.c auth2.c sshd.c] | 37 | [auth.h auth1.c auth2.c sshd.c] |
38 | have the authentication functions return the authentication context | 38 | have the authentication functions return the authentication context |
39 | and then do_authenticated; okay millert@ | 39 | and then do_authenticated; okay millert@ |
40 | - dugsong@cvs.openbsd.org 2002/03/18 01:30:10 | ||
41 | [auth-krb4.c] | ||
42 | set client to NULL after xfree(), from Rolf Braun | ||
43 | <rbraun+ssh@andrew.cmu.edu> | ||
40 | 44 | ||
41 | 20020317 | 45 | 20020317 |
42 | - (tim) [configure.ac] Assume path given with --with-pid-dir=PATH is wanted, | 46 | - (tim) [configure.ac] Assume path given with --with-pid-dir=PATH is wanted, |
@@ -7883,4 +7887,4 @@ | |||
7883 | - Wrote replacements for strlcpy and mkdtemp | 7887 | - Wrote replacements for strlcpy and mkdtemp |
7884 | - Released 1.0pre1 | 7888 | - Released 1.0pre1 |
7885 | 7889 | ||
7886 | $Id: ChangeLog,v 1.1935 2002/03/22 01:27:35 mouring Exp $ | 7890 | $Id: ChangeLog,v 1.1936 2002/03/22 01:30:40 mouring Exp $ |
diff --git a/auth-krb4.c b/auth-krb4.c index f7a144f9d..2a3cf5314 100644 --- a/auth-krb4.c +++ b/auth-krb4.c | |||
@@ -23,7 +23,7 @@ | |||
23 | */ | 23 | */ |
24 | 24 | ||
25 | #include "includes.h" | 25 | #include "includes.h" |
26 | RCSID("$OpenBSD: auth-krb4.c,v 1.25 2001/12/19 07:18:56 deraadt Exp $"); | 26 | RCSID("$OpenBSD: auth-krb4.c,v 1.26 2002/03/18 01:30:10 dugsong Exp $"); |
27 | 27 | ||
28 | #include "ssh.h" | 28 | #include "ssh.h" |
29 | #include "ssh1.h" | 29 | #include "ssh1.h" |
@@ -253,6 +253,7 @@ auth_krb4(Authctxt *authctxt, KTEXT auth, char **client) | |||
253 | log("Kerberos v4 .klogin authorization failed for %s to " | 253 | log("Kerberos v4 .klogin authorization failed for %s to " |
254 | "account %s", *client, authctxt->user); | 254 | "account %s", *client, authctxt->user); |
255 | xfree(*client); | 255 | xfree(*client); |
256 | *client = NULL; | ||
256 | return (0); | 257 | return (0); |
257 | } | 258 | } |
258 | /* Increment the checksum, and return it encrypted with the | 259 | /* Increment the checksum, and return it encrypted with the |